Cultivating a Growth Mindset

A pivotal component of resilience is adopting a growth mindset. As popularized by Carol Dweck, a growth mindset is the belief that abilities and intelligence can be developed through dedication and hard work. This contrasts with a fixed mindset, which assumes that these qualities are innate and unchangeable. Individuals with a growth mindset are more likely to embrace challenges, persist in the face of setbacks, and view failure as an opportunity to learn and improve. They understand that effort is essential for mastery and that setbacks are simply part of the learning process. Fostering a growth mindset requires a shift in perspective, focusing on effort, strategy, and progress rather than solely on outcomes. It's about celebrating the journey of learning and development, not just the achievement of a final result.

Mindset Characteristics Impact on Resilience
Fixed Mindset Belief in innate abilities; Avoids challenges; Gives up easily Lower resilience; Views failure as a reflection of ability
Growth Mindset Belief in developed abilities; Embraces challenges; Persists through setbacks Higher resilience; Views failure as an opportunity to learn

The table above clearly illustrates the different approaches to challenges and the subsequent impact on one’s ability to bounce back. Developing a growth mindset is a deliberate practice and contributes significantly to building that all-important resilience.

Strategies for Strengthening Determination

Strengthening determination isn't solely about willpower; it involves implementing practical strategies to maintain focus and motivation. Breaking down large goals into smaller, more manageable steps is crucial. This allows for a sense of accomplishment with each milestone achieved, fostering continued momentum. Setting realistic deadlines and tracking progress provides a tangible measure of success and reinforces commitment. Surrounding oneself with a supportive network of individuals who share similar goals can offer encouragement and accountability. Visualizing success and regularly reminding oneself of the reasons for pursuing a particular goal can also strengthen resolve. Finally, celebrating achievements, however small, is essential for maintaining motivation and reinforcing positive behavior.

  • Set SMART goals (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time-bound)
  • Create a detailed action plan
  • Eliminate distractions and prioritize tasks
  • Seek support from mentors and peers
  • Practice self-discipline and consistency

These strategies, when implemented consistently, can significantly bolster someone's determination and enhance their ability to achieve ambitious goals. The willingness to remain steadfast, even when progress seems slow, is a hallmark of those who ultimately succeed.
